Kurka - Deo, Aurangabad

Kurka is a village situated in the Deo subdivision of Aurangabad district, Bihar. It is located approximately 3 km from the tehsil headquarters in Deo and around 17 km from the district headquarters in Aurangabad. Israur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kurka village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kurka is 254356. The village covers a total geographical area of 61.4 hectares and falls under the 824202 pincode. Aurangabad is the nearest town, located about 17 km away.

Kurka village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Mukhiya ser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Aurangabad Assembly and Parliamentary constituency.

Population of Kurka

According to the 2011 Census, Kurka village had a total population of 670 people, including 351 males and 319 females, living in 101 households. The sex ratio was 909 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 75.69%, with male literacy at 87.94% and female literacy at 62.45%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 112.

Transport and Connectivity of Kurka

Kurka is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. Kurka has a railway station.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Aurangabad to Kurka is about 17 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
